Sesame Date Grain-free Granola

No ratings yet
Serves: 6 servings
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cooking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 45 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 cup almonds, roughly chopped
  • 1 cup cashews, chopped
  • 1 cup raw walnuts
  • 1/4 cup chia seeds
  • 1/4 cup sesame seeds
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 3 tbsp coconut oil
  • 1/3 cup date syrup (silan)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• Pinch salt

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 325 F
  2. In a large bowl, combine the nuts, seeds and cinnamon and mix together.
  3. Melt the coconut oil in the microwave for 1 minute, then whisk it together with the date syrup and vanilla extract until thick and smooth.
  4. Pour the wet mixture over the nuts and stir together until evenly combined.
  5. Transfer to a parchment lined baking sheet and flatten down using a rubber spatula.
  6. Bake for about 25-30 minutes on the middle rack. Remove from oven and let cool completely before breaking apart. The granola may still feel a little wet when you remove it from the oven, but it will harden as it cools.
  7. Once cool, break apart into clumps or pieces and store in an airtight container for about 2 weeks, or freeze for 3 months. After breaking apart, you can mix in dried fruit, chocolate chips or freeze-dried fruit if desired.
